Transaction 668dcdd142be683ed2ddf59233655676dad7f007758b9d230c9c9dbba0c472ae
1 Input
1 Output
-
668dcdd142be683ed2ddf59233655676dad7f007758b9d230c9c9dbba0c472ae:0
- value
- 17210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15dbd50a9f54cc03062733c8d6163ecbda5402f6 OP_EQUAL
- address
- 33gbTnEjNsY5h6GYMJh7RC6uXHUTvDDk13